"Vortex" is a contemporary custom with a heavy performance edge by
Weaver Customs. This 1953 Chevrolet Bel Air is packed with many
custom all-steel body modifications, including a 1.75-inch chop,
windshield leaned back 1.75 inches, wedge-sectioned hood, mohawk
roof and decklid, belly pan, flush-mount glass, supercar-inspired
front and rear valances, custom brake vents, rocker treatments and
suicide doors. The car is covered in Axalta custom gray paint with
hand-brushed black chrome accents. Vortex features an LSX 376ci V-8
engine with vintage twin-superchargers, TH350 three-speed automatic
transmission with a 3500 stall, Art Morrison chassis, Boze wheels
(20x15 rear, 18x8 front) and Mickey Thompson tires. The interior
features Hyde's Italian leather trimmed by JS Custom Interiors. An
all-steel hand-fabricated dash, waterfall console and hand-built
roll bar hoops set Vortex's style. The interior is also
accessorized with custom Dakota Digital gauges and Kicker audio. It
has been honored as the 2019 World's Ultimate GM. Other accolades
include LS Fest Grand Champion, Street Rodder Top 100, Goodguys
awards and multiple ISCA awards, including Best Engineered and Full
Radical Hand Built. Vortex was undefeated at Hot August Nights
2018. Along with its show career, Vortex has been showcased as a
feature vehicle for the Hot Rod Power Tour. It was also featured in
the Adam's Polishes booth at SEMA 2018, where it was part of Battle
of the Builders and named a Top Five vehicle at SEMA. Vortex has
been featured in Street Rodder magazine and The Shop, along with
many online articles.
